Three Main Approaches in Psychology

  • Biological Approach: How behaviors are affected by biological features (brain, neurons, neurotransmitters, hormones)
  • Cognitive Approach: How memory affects behaviors and actions
  • Socio-Cultural Approach: Psychology in terms of group interactions and cultural dimensions

Biological Approach

  • Main Concern: Study the biological correlates of behavior or physical correlates of behavior
  • Focus on the Brain: Exploring how brain complexity, neural connections influence behaviors

Subtopic: Brain Localization

  • Concept: Certain areas of the brain correspond with specific functions
  • History: Previous ideas like left brain/right brain have been debunked but localization remains a valid concept
  • Main Lobes of the Brain:
    • Frontal Lobe
    • Parietal Lobe
    • Occipital Lobe
    • Temporal Lobe
  • Language Center: Example of a localized function with Broca's area as a specific sub-region

Case Studies in Brain Localization

Phineas Gage

  • Incident: Iron rod passed through his skull
  • Researcher: Harlow observed personality changes
  • Conclusion: Frontal lobe involved in personality
  • Note: Importance of distinguishing correlation from causation

Milner and Scoville (HM Case Study)

  • Incident: Bike accident led to seizures and later brain surgery
  • Researchers: Milner, Scoville, and Corkin (administered MRI)
  • Outcome: Developed anterograde amnesia; partial retrograde amnesia
  • Conclusion: Hippocampus plays a role in memory encoding

Critical Evaluation

  • Generalization: Limited due to small sample size and uniqueness of cases
  • Strengths: Longitudinal studies allow for technological advances (e.g., MRI scans) to corroborate findings
